Attachmate Corporation is a 1982-founded software company which focused on secure terminal emulation, legacy integration, and managed file transfer software. Attachmate CorporationEdit
Attachmate was founded in 1982 by Frank W. Pritt.<ref name=DC.0>{{#invoke:citation/CS1|citation |CitationClass=web }}</ref> It focused initially on the IBM terminal emulation market, and became a major technology employer in the Seattle area.<ref name=WRQ.CG>{{#invoke:citation/CS1|citation |CitationClass=web }}</ref>
KeaTermEdit
KEAsystems' KEAterm products were PC software packages that emulated some of Digital Equipment Corporation's VT terminals, and facilitated integrating Windows-based PCs with multiple host applications.<ref name=CW93>Template:Cite news</ref><ref>{{#invoke:citation/CS1|citation |CitationClass=web }}</ref> These included KEAterm VT340 and VT420 terminal emulators, and KEA X X terminal software).
KEA was acquired by Attachmate.<ref name=KEA.ChadGad>{{#invoke:citation/CS1|citation |CitationClass=web }}</ref>
DCA IRMAEdit
Another acquisition was Digital Communications Associates (DCA), makers of IRMA line of terminal emulators, INFOconnect, Crosstalk communications software, and OpenMind collaborative software).<ref name=DC.0/> DCA was also known for its 3270 IRMA<ref>Template:Cite book</ref> hardware product (used for SDLC), and ISCA SDLC hardware adapters. AcquisitionEdit
After buying both WRQ, Inc. and Attachmate, who had been long-time competitors in the host emulation business, a group of private equity firms announced in 2005 that the companies would be merged under the new ownership.<ref name=WRQ.CG/> It was announced that Attachmate founder and CEO Frank Pritt would retire at the same time.Template:Citation needed
